This week on Not From Concentrate, Catherine Smart talks with freelance baker Mackenzie Innis about the artistry, logistics, and emotional weight behind her beautiful seasonal cakes. Mackenzie shares how she moved from fine dining pastry kitchens to building Ceres, a freelance baking business rooted in seasonality, local ingredients, florals, and deeply personal celebrations. She talks about turning clients’ food memories into wedding cakes, sourcing from New England farms, growing flowers in Somerville, and finding inspiration in bakeries, gardens, mythology, and community. Catherine and Mackenzie also talk about the less-glamorous but essential parts of creative solopreneurship: email, bookkeeping, client communication, systems, structure, and managing a busy brain while running a business. Plus, they get into Boston-area bakeries, wedding cake etiquette, edible flowers, slowing down, calming kitchen chaos, and why cake can still matter in complicated times.
